CBSE Class 12 Results 2026: The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) is set to release the Class 12 results very soon. The Class 10 results have already been released. The CBSE Board may release the Class 12 results for 2026 today, April 21. However, the exact date and time for the result declaration have not yet been officially confirmed. Citing sources, media reports suggest that the CBSE may release the results either today or by Friday.

Typically, the CBSE Board releases the Class 12 results one or two days after declaring the Class 10 results. In 2025, the Board released the results for both classes in mid-May.

Where to Check Results?
Once the results are declared, students will be able to check them via the official result websites: cbse.nic.in, results.cbse.nic.in, and cbse.gov.in. To view their results, students will require their Roll Number, School Number, and Admit Card ID. In addition to the official websites, students can also access their results through DigiLocker, SMS services, and the UMANG mobile app.

UMANG and DigiLocker Apps
The Board has instructed schools to provide students with a 6-digit ‘Security PIN.’ Using this PIN, students will be able to download their mark sheets from DigiLocker. In the event that the website crashes, students can also check their results through the UMANG app and the IVRS service.

How ​​to Check CBSE Class 12 Results

First, students must visit the official website.

Next, they need to click on the ‘CBSE 12th Result 2026’ link.

Subsequently, they must enter their Roll Number, School Number, and Admit Card ID.

The result will then appear on the screen.

How to Check Results via DigiLocker
To do this, first visit digilocker.gov.in or open the DigiLocker app on your mobile device.
You will then need to log in using your registered mobile number or Aadhaar number.

Next, navigate to the ‘Issued Documents’ section.

From there, select the ‘CBSE’ option.

Then, click on ‘Class 12 Marksheet 2026’.

Finally, enter your Roll Number and the Year of Passing.

You will then be able to download your digital marksheet.
